Karma, the universal law of cause and effect, is the root of the ‘Tree of Life’. It is an invisible force that influences the destiny of an individual, a family, a nation, or the world.
The Holy Bible says, “A man reaps what he sows.” The Holy Quran echoes this by stating, “Thou shall receive requital and reward in just return for whatsoever thou does.” The Buddha says, “So long as the evil action does not mature Karmically, the fool thinks his action to be as sweet as honey. But when it matures, the fool experiences untold misery.”
